This is a suggestion from someone who is not too computer savvy but has had to deal with a couple of poker site download issues.

After deleting all bodog related files and folders:

1) make sure you are logged on as the Administrator

2) use Microsoft Internet Explorer to accomplish the download, especially if it is not your normal browser

3) tell your firewall to allow the bodog software full access

hope this helps
